Tarquin Douglass Posted June 25, 2010 Share Posted June 25, 2010 I have finally got my Acer Aspire 8940G working 99.9% with SL. What is working: CPU: Vanilla Speedstep Vanilla Power Management Graphics: Vanilla QE/CI OpenGL/CL Network: Ethernet (I had to hex edit the 10.6.3 AppleBCM5701Ethernet.kext to get it to work 100%) auto MAC address detection and no need for promisc mode. Wireless (I had to swap the WiFi minipci card with a Atheros AR5B91 to get it working) USB: Vanilla Bluetoooth: Vanilla SATA: Vanilla Audio: VoodooHDA (mike working 100%) SDHC: Working 100% (With SD Card pluged in on boot) Camera: Vanilla Battery: VoodooBattery Trackpad / Keyboard: VoodooPS2 Shutdown and Restart working 100% Hibernation working 100% Since 10.6.4 it has been stable as a rock, no crashing or freezing. The only thing that I have not managed to get working yet is sleep, but I am working on that. I have made a package that will install all the kexts, bootloader, DSDT, smbios that is needed to get it working. After you run the installer you must run the kext utility that is installed in /Applications/Utilities/Tools. This is to fix permissions. Run this installer after you have updated to 10.6.4. Tarquin Douglass Posted June 27, 2010 Author Share Posted June 27, 2010 I have found that VoodooHDA causes a kernel panic on boot at least 50% of the time, you just need to reboot until it boots successfully. When it has booted it does not panic, and is very stable. For this reason I am now using AppleHDA and LegacyHDA for sound. The only problem with this is that the mic does not work. omnidecay Posted February 17, 2011 Share Posted February 17, 2011 I thought I would come in here and explain how I got SL 10.6.6 almost working 100% on my Aspire 8940g. I posted a longer version of how to do this but here is a MUCH more streamlined and functioning version. What you will need: [url="http://www.insanelymac.com/forum/topic/279450-why-insanelymac-does-not-support-tonymacx86/"]#####[/url] + [url="http://www.insanelymac.com/forum/topic/279450-why-insanelymac-does-not-support-tonymacx86/"]#####[/url] (google) Retail SL disc Pacifist (download the .dmg) Acer Aspire 8940g.pkg (from OP) SL 10.6.6 combo update (google; make sure its the COMBO update) Notes: Place all downloaded items onto a FAT32 formatted thumb drive. It HAS to be FAT32 otherwise OSX wont read it. Process: 1) Download [url="http://www.insanelymac.com/forum/topic/279450-why-insanelymac-does-not-support-tonymacx86/"]#####[/url] and burn it to a cd. Place it in your computer and restart. Make sure your 8940g is set to boot from DVD drive first. Press F2 at ACER boot screen. 2) When [url="http://www.insanelymac.com/forum/topic/279450-why-insanelymac-does-not-support-tonymacx86/"]#####[/url] screen appears eject the cd and place in your SL retail disk. Wait a couple seconds and press F5. Then when the SL disk shows up, press -x. Select the SL retail disk and hit enter. notes: We press -x to go into safe mode. Your retail disk doesnt support core i7 or the GTS 250M in out 8940g. -x puts us in safe mode and bypasses these components and lets us run the install. 3) It will go through the install process and enter in all the info you need. 4) Once you get to your desktop, plug in your thumb drive from above and copy all items onto the desktop. 5) Double click the 10.6.6 combo update and let the installer run. Reboot your computer once finished. 6) Place the [url="http://www.insanelymac.com/forum/topic/279450-why-insanelymac-does-not-support-tonymacx86/"]#####[/url] cd back in the drive once the computer has shut down. When the [url="http://www.insanelymac.com/forum/topic/279450-why-insanelymac-does-not-support-tonymacx86/"]#####[/url] menu appears back on your screen select your hard drive and hit enter. 7) Back at your desktop, install the program pacifist. Once installed, go to Applications > Pacifist and run it. It will launch and a welcome screen will appear with a count down. Just wait for it to finish and hit not now (but buy it if you like it). Hit the button Open Package and select the Acer Aspire 8940g.pkg. 8) Locate the DSDT.aml and the AppleBCM5701Ethernet.kext and copy those to the desktop as well. Close down Pacifist when done. 9) Go to: System > Library > Extensions and locate IONetworkingFamily.kext...Right click this and select Show Package Contents....Navigate to Contents > PlugIns and delete the existing AppleBCM5701Ethernet.kext that is in this folder. Empty the trash as well. Now click and drag the AppleBCM5701Ethernet.kext that is on your desktop into this PlugIns folder. If it asks for you password at anytime just enter it. Close the folders when finished. 10) Now run the Acer Aspire 8940g.pkg and wait for the installer to finish. 11) Once thats done run the [url="http://www.insanelymac.com/forum/topic/279450-why-insanelymac-does-not-support-tonymacx86/"]#####[/url] installer and select the option UserDSDT and hit continue. Let it run through its install and reboot once finished. Take out the [url="http://www.insanelymac.com/forum/topic/279450-why-insanelymac-does-not-support-tonymacx86/"]#####[/url] cd from your drive before you hit reboot. 12) Now that we are back at the desktop once more. Go to Applications folder and locate the kextutility. Run it and let it do its thing. When its finished reboot one last time. You should now be back at your desktop with a fully functioning Acer Aspire 8940g hackintosh running 10.6.6 :-)...Wifi will not work since there arent drivers for our cards.
